Output 06afa7e7e495faabf4c46f8372d8003f80db37abb292f1fd5dd1204a3b834ef2:6

value
10468460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ba20242a95ce9a1b21e495619a5d1659f8bc81e9 OP_EQUAL
address
3JfA7SRWJuotdUEHmevyDoV3bVAXHEXiVA
transaction
06afa7e7e495faabf4c46f8372d8003f80db37abb292f1fd5dd1204a3b834ef2
spent
true